Malaxis macrophylla (Schltr.) P.F.Hunt 1970 Type Drawing by © Schlechter and The Swiss Orchid Foundation at the Jany Renz Herbaria Website
Common Name The Large Leaved Malaxis
Flower Size
Found in New Guinea at elevations around 200 to 500 meters as a hot growing terrestrial with a short stem carrying 4 to 6, erect-patent, obliquely ovate to elliptic-lanceolate, acute to acuminate, glabrous, petiolate base leaves that blooms in the spring and summer on a 16" [40 cm] long, many flowered inflorescence.
Synonyms Crepidium macrophyllum (Schltr.) Szlach. 1995; *Microstylis macrophylla Schltr. 1905
References W3 Tropicos, Kew Monocot list , IPNI ; Orchidaceae of German New Guinea Schlechter 1911 as Microstylis macrophylla Drawing fide;
